Thunderstorm Wind — East Carroll, Louisiana
2009-05-10 · near Shelburn, East Carroll, Louisiana
Event narrative
A swath of damaging winds north of Lake Providence caused numerous trees, power poles, and power lines to have been blown down. Substantial damage occurred to the Shelburn Fire Station and numerous homes were damaged. A tree fell on a house on Highland Road.
Wider weather episode
During the afternoon and evening of the 10th, a small outbreak of severe storms occurred across the ArkLaMiss region. There were a number of reports of hail, wind damage, and a few tornadoes across the region. One of the strongest storms moved across Sharkey county. This storm produced an EF1 tornado in the Delta National Forest. Another strong storm produced three injuries in Rankin County, when broken and flying glass from a vehicle injured 3 people. Winds were estimated at 70 mph.
